NEW LIBRARY HEAD ELECTED

Mrs. C. L. Harmonson Elected President of Smyrna Library Commission

G. W. WRIGHT REPORTS

Mrs. C. L. Harmonson was elected president of the Smyrna Library Commission at its quarterly meeting here on February 6. Mrs. Harmonson, who has long been identified with projects to develop and expand local library facilities, was also named by the members of the commission as chairman of the book committee. She will be assisted in the work of the committee by Miss Elizabeth Thornley. Glenn S. King was re-elected as vice-president and George W. Wright as treasurer. Richard Price and Miss Thornley, newly-appointed members of the commission, were named as the house committee, which has charge of the maintenance and improvement of the quarters occupied by the library. Mr. Wright explained in detail the financial background of the Smyrna Library and complimented the president-elect for the excellent work of the book committee in securing new books and in providing representative magazines within the limits of the budget.
